Output 03d8ea82b1513f534f8e97c44a542736301f96d965b45673fe61bb3f7deada80:21

value
667309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6936659b47967d39bfd5fa172bc449b285a99e5 OP_EQUAL
address
3GsnfuUzi2XEj5WWXcBFg9rKbDHbpZTLac
transaction
03d8ea82b1513f534f8e97c44a542736301f96d965b45673fe61bb3f7deada80
confirmations
245917
spent
true